Guest::I have family videos and pictures on an external hard drive with usb in my nighthawk router. I can see the files (readyshare)through VLC media app. However I want to use Kodi. In the past I used SMB workgroup . I understand it is no longer available . How can I network KODI to the router (readyshare)?
-
Nathan Kinkead
Keymaster::Hi Ron, I think what you’re looking for is UPnP. Here are instruction on how to add the DLNA media source from your network share into your Kodi library using UPnP. https://kodi.wiki/view/UPnP/Media_source
